I don't have a recommendation for a paid product.   However, you can pull all three of your CR's once per year.  I would recommend you print (or print to PDF) your reports.  TU and EQ will not let you back without paying for 12 months.  There are {Edited}, but I wouldn't recommend them unless you really are denied credit based on your credit report.

 

If you keep the report number for EX, you can use it to pull an updated full EX report as often as you like.  You do need to have pulled the report within 90 days for this to work.  This is the best way to see the last time American Express SP'd you.   I don't have the myFICO paid product, but I doubt it will show SPs.

 

If you sign up for Credit Karma, they will give you free weekly TU reports.  They don't show SP's, but it will show everything else.

 

I haven't found as good of a way to view my EQ reports.  The best I have done is Quizzle will give you a free report every 180 days or so.  Quizzle does try to get you purchase updated reports so their "advice" is more current.   The advice CK and Quizzle provide is good to read.   But don't rely on it.  They make their money getting you to apply for new CC's and loans.   I have found some of the advice quite comical. 

 

I believe CK offers free credit alerts based on changes in your credit report. Quizzle tries to get you to pay for credit alerts.   However, I don't use that feature. 

 

Credit Sesame and Credit.com offers similar services as CK and Quizzle based on your EX report.  However, I have never used their services.

 

None of the above will give you a free FICO score, but you already have your TU-08 score taken care of.  I expect more CC's will provide FICO scores in the future.    The FAKO scores they provide are:

Credit.com and CS - EX National Equivalency Score

Quizzle - Vantage (not sure if it is 2.0 or 3.0)

CK - TU TransRisk New Account and Vantage 2.0 scores

CK also shows an Home Insurance and Auto Insurance scores.  I don't know where they come from.  I haven't found them useful.

 

Note: I don't know if CK or Quizzle has the same restrictions for new SSN's and myFICO.  However, since they are free it doesn't hurt to try.
